Holder Incorporated uses the weighted average method for its process costing system.The Assembly Department at began March with 24,000 units in Work in Process (WIP)Inventory,all of which were completed and transferred out during March.An additional 32,000 units were started during the month,12,000 of which were completed and transferred out during March.A total of 20,000 units remained in Work in Process Inventory at the end of March,and were at varying levels of completion as follows:
Direct materials: 80 percent complete
Direct labor: 60 percent complete
Overhead: 70 percent complete
